Output 1048b1bc37ddf995141086aacc36dbfcc9c524d8bd100fb9048694075427d246:0

value
17403590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61282c811fc44d2dd33464eee2198c793b31d536 OP_EQUAL
address
3AYjbUjeBkVmEUkKMMeFpCmstmDyxsmnZe
transaction
1048b1bc37ddf995141086aacc36dbfcc9c524d8bd100fb9048694075427d246
confirmations
426998
spent
true